Chapter 1
My fiancé was going to humiliate me at our own wedding.
I know because I heard him think it.
I'm Isabella Rossi — mafia heiress, future bride to Lorenzo Falcone, the golden boy of New York's underworld. Our marriage was supposed to unite two empires.
I also have a secret. I can read minds. But only when people want to use me, hurt me, or destroy me.
Lorenzo's thoughts had been silent for three years. I thought that meant he loved me.
The night before the wedding, I finally heard him. The mistress he'd planted in the crowd. The fake pregnancy reveal. The plan to humiliate me at the altar so he could play the victim — and steal my family's power in the chaos.
I didn't show up.
I took his money. Ruined his name. And left the country.
Isabella's POV
"Darling, this dress was made for you."
Lorenzo Falcone stood by the floor-to-ceiling window of the bridal boutique, whiskey in hand. Those brown eyes of his were warm enough to melt steel. He crossed the room and kissed my bare shoulder.
"You'll be the most beautiful bride on the entire East Coast. Hell, in the whole damn country."
"Thank you." I kept my eyes on my reflection.
The lace and diamonds covering every inch of the gown caught the light from the crystal chandeliers overhead, scattering tiny sparks across the walls.
As the eldest daughter of the Rossi family, this wedding was never just about two people. This was a union between two of New York's most powerful crime families — Falcone and Rossi. The alliance of the century.
I was about to turn and kiss him when a voice detonated inside my skull.
"This dress is way too heavy. When Sophia bursts in after the ring exchange tomorrow, Isabella won't be able to chase her down wearing this thing. Perfect. I'll just throw my hands up and tell the old men I can't abandon a woman carrying my child. The Rossis will swallow it whole — they can't afford the embarrassment."
Every drop of blood in my body went ice cold.
I stood perfectly still, eyes locked on Lorenzo in the mirror. His lips hadn't moved. That flawless, devastating smile was still right where he'd left it.
Once I was sure — dead sure — that those words had come from inside his head, I didn't move. Didn't breathe.
Not entirely because of the cheap, soap-opera bullshit he was planning. Mostly because of the other thing. The thing that knocked the floor out from under me.
I had just heard his thoughts.
I discovered the ability when I was sixteen. I could hear what people were thinking — but with one brutal catch: it only worked on people who didn't love me. People who wished me harm, or simply didn't give a damn.
Lorenzo and I had been together three years. Engaged for one. In all that time, whenever he was near me, my head stayed quiet. I'd told myself it was because he truly loved me. That he was the exception.
Turns out, he was just the delay.
"Hey — what's wrong, Bella?" Lorenzo noticed my stillness. He frowned. "You look pale."
He reached for me.
"Don't you DARE get sick right now. Tomorrow is the day Falcone swallows the Rossi docks whole. The wedding cannot go sideways. I just need to survive tomorrow — then I can set Sophia up in the Long Island house, nice and quiet."
His voice again. Grinding through my head like broken glass.
I swallowed hard, turned slightly, pretended to fix my earring. His hand found nothing but air.
"Oh, I'm fine." I turned back, smile locked and loaded. "Just the corset. It's too tight."
Growing up inside a world built on blood and betrayal, the first lesson they teach you is this: never let your enemy see you crack.
"Okay, good." He relaxed. He glanced at his watch. "Hey, I gotta go over tomorrow's security with my father. With all five family heads attending, we can't afford any gaps."
"And I need to check on Sophia. Poor stupid girl is probably falling apart right now. I have to make sure she cries hard enough tomorrow — put on enough of a show that everyone buys the whole 'couldn't fight fate' angle."
"Go." I kept smiling. "Don't keep him waiting."
The moment the heavy mahogany door clicked shut, my face dropped.
I stared at the woman in the mirror — pristine white lace, diamonds, the whole performance — and let out a slow, hollow laugh.
Who the HELL would've thought that this kind of trashy, basic-cable plotline — the secret girlfriend crashing the wedding — would happen to me? Isabella Rossi. The most feared heir in New York's underworld.
Lorenzo. Lorenzo. You're not just a liar. You're a goddamn idiot.
You actually thought you could walk all over the Rossi name — use our family's wedding as cover for your little reunion with some civilian girl?
I grabbed my phone off the sofa and pulled up a contact: Firecracker.
"Chloe." She picked up to a wall of thrashing metal. I talked right over it. "I need you to pull everything on a woman named Sophia. Three years of call records, medical records — and I specifically want any OB-GYN files from the last few months."
I paused.
"Oh, and book me a first-class seat on the ten a.m. flight to Geneva. Tomorrow."
The music cut out.
"Okay, hold on." Chloe's voice sharpened. "Ten a.m. tomorrow? Isabella, that's when you're supposed to be walking into St. Patrick's Cathedral. What the hell is going on?"
"I'm not losing my mind, Chloe." I poured two fingers of vodka. Threw it back.
It burned all the way down. Good. I needed to feel something that clean.
"I'm just finally thinking straight." I set it down. "He wants a scene?"
I smiled.
"Fine. Then let's give the man a show."
